Stara Rudnica[ˈstara rudˈnit͡sa] (German:Altrüdnitz) is avillage in the administrative district ofGmina Cedynia, withinGryfino County,West Pomeranian Voivodeship, in north-western Poland, close to theGerman border.[1] It lies approximately 6 km (4 mi) south ofCedynia, 50 km (31 mi) south ofGryfino, and 70 km (43 mi) south of the regional capitalSzczecin.
